Tai Chi moves de-stress staff

Mental health staff from charity Second Step downed tools for half an hour on Wednesday lunchtime in a bid to de-stress with an outdoor Tai Chi lesson.

To mark Mental Health Awareness Week (14 – 20 May) with its focus on stress, staff from the Bristol-based mental health charity found some inner calm, thanks to Tai Chi teacher John Bruce from the Bristol School of Tai Chi.

Michael Pearson, a senior manager at Second Step, said: “It was a great experience – we all felt much more relaxed after the half-hour session. And we certainly attracted a lot of attention!”

“It’s so important to find ways to de-stress while at work and taking half an hour for Tai Chi did just that,” he added.

A YouGov survey commissioned by the Mental Health Foundation for Mental Health Awareness Week found that 74% of us were so stressed we felt overwhelmed or unable to cope.
